Taking Care Of the Knocked-Out Tooth
If you have actually knocked out a tooth, handle it thoroughly to enhance the opportunities of successful reattachment. Initially, find the tooth and choose it up by the crown, avoiding touching the origin. It's critical to keep the tooth wet, so preferably, attempt to carefully place it back right into the outlet.
If that's not practical, save the tooth in a container with milk or your saliva to keep it moisturized. Bear in mind not to scrub or clean the tooth with any chemicals, as this can harm the fragile tissues needed for reattachment.
Avoid covering the tooth in tissue or fabric, as this can lead to dehydration. Time is essential, so seek oral care immediately. The longer the tooth is out of its outlet, the lower the chances of effective reimplantation.
Immediate Emergency Treatment Steps
Start by delicately washing your mouth with warm water to clean the location around the knocked-out tooth. This will assist remove any dust or debris that may be present. Beware not to scrub or touch the root of the tooth, as this can trigger further damages.
Next off, preferably, try to place the tooth back right into its outlet. Hold it in position by carefully biting down on a clean item of gauze or cloth. If you can't return the tooth, don't force it. Rather, keep it damp by positioning it in a cup of milk or saline remedy. Stay clear of saving the tooth in water as it can damage the root cells.
To handle any bleeding, use mild stress to the location utilizing a tidy gauze or towel. You can likewise use a chilly compress to lower swelling and relieve discomfort. Remember to take over the counter pain medication as required.
